SM8958A芯片技术规格与特性解析

需积分: 14 8 下载量 92 浏览量 更新于2025-01-03 收藏 562KB PDF 举报
"SM8958A是一款微控制器芯片,由SyncMOSTechnologiesInc.制造。该芯片有不同版本,适用于不同的电压范围:L版本工作电压为3.0V~3.6V,C版本工作电压为4.5V~5.5V。这款芯片基于8052家族,具有兼容性,并且在机器周期内执行12个时钟周期。" SM8958A芯片的主要特性包括: 1. **内存配置**:它配备了32K字节的片上程序闪存和1024字节的片上数据RAM,提供足够的存储空间来运行程序和临时存储数据。 2. **定时器/计数器**:拥有三个16位定时器/计数器,可以用于各种时间控制和计数应用。 3. **看门狗定时器**:确保系统在主程序出现故障时能够复位,提高系统的稳定性。 4. **I/O端口**:对于PDIP封装,提供四个8位I/O端口;对于PLC或QFP封装,提供四个8位I/O端口加上一个4位I/O端口,增强了外部设备连接能力。 5. **串行通道**:支持全双工串行通信,可用于与其他设备进行数据交换。 6. **位操作指令**:允许对单个位进行操作,增强了编程灵活性。 7. **工业级标准**:设计满足工业环境的要求,能适应各种工作条件。 8. **算术运算**:支持8位无符号除法和乘法,以及BCD(二进制编码十进制)运算。 9. **寻址模式**:包括直接寻址和间接寻址,提供了灵活的数据访问方式。 10. **中断管理**:具有嵌套中断功能,两个优先级级别的中断处理,可以高效处理中断事件。 11. **串行I/O端口**:提供了一个串行输入/输出端口,用于串行通信。 12. **节能模式**:包含空闲模式和电源下降模式,可以在不活动时降低功耗。 13. **代码保护功能**:防止未经授权的代码访问和修改。 14. **低电磁干扰**:通过抑制ALE(地址锁存使能)信号来减少电磁辐射。 15. **片上RAM的银行映射直接寻址模式**:优化了对片上RAM的访问。 16. **SPWM功能**:五个通道的SPWM(脉宽调制)功能,可以利用P1.3到P1.7引脚生成高质量的模拟信号。 SM8958A芯片提供了三种封装选项:40LPDIP、44LPLCC和44LQFP,每个封装的尺寸信息分别在相应的页面上列出。产品列表中还包括SM8958AL25,这是一个工作频率为25MHz的版本,具有32KB的内部存储。 这些特性使得SM8958A芯片适用于各种嵌入式系统,如工业自动化、智能家居、汽车电子、仪器仪表等需要高效能、低功耗和强大外设接口的应用场景。开发人员可以根据具体项目需求选择适合的电压版本和封装类型。